A packet sniffer also known as a packet analyzer, is a computer software or hardware tool that can be used to intercept, log and analyze network traffic and data that passes through a digital network.
Legitimate packet sniffers are used for routine examination and problem detection while Unauthorized packet sniffers are used to steal information.
Packet sniffers serve as network diagnostic tools used by administrators and can be used illicitly to steal network data. They are not easy to detect and don't use viruses to capture data.
Explanation:A packet sniffer can be referred to as a computer software or hardware designed to intercept and log traffic on a digital network. They function as network diagnostic tools used by administrators to troubleshoot and optimize network operations. Legitimate sniffers are indeed used for routine examination and problem detection. On the other hand, unauthorized sniffers are illicitly used to steal information by capturing sensitive data traveling over the network. Unfortunately, contrary to intuition, packet sniffers are not relatively easy to detect because data transmission over networks is typically public. Furthermore, packet sniffers do not use viruses to capture data packets, they simply log the packets moving through networks.

The technician should configure the RAID 0 for Joe.
RAID 0 also referred to as the striped volume or stripe set is configured to allow the fastest speed and the most storage capacity by splitting data evenly across multiple (at least two) disks, without redundancy and parity information.
Also, RAID 0 isn't fault tolerant, as failure of one drive will cause the entire array to fail thereby causing total data loss.

Modems in the 1990s converted digital information into analog signals for transmission over phone lines, enabling users to connect to early online service providers. As internet content grew, broadband connections using cable lines became more prevalent for faster speeds.
Explanation:The uses of a modem are crucial to understanding how early internet users connected to the burgeoning online world. In the 1990s, modems became faster and more widely utilized with the advent of the internet. These devices worked by converting digital information from a computer into analog signals that could be transmitted over phone lines, and then back into digital form at the destination.
Initially, modems enabled users to connect to online service providers like America Online (AOL) using standard phone lines, functioning in a similar way to Bulletin Board Systems (BBSs). However, with the explosion of internet content, service providers shifted towards broadband connections using cable television lines and dedicated lines for faster data transfer.

Rogue access point also known as rogue AP is a wireless access point installed on a secure network infrastructure either by an employee or a malicious hacker but without explicit authorization from the local network administrator.
